It has been around 4 months already since I have been complaining of my globe load credits being eaten.
Since then I have been dumbfounded about the reason why my load magically disappears overnight and is always simultaneous with my Globe unlitxt or sulitxt expiration time.
And I just found it out, with some keen observation and some curious questions, I was able to find out the culprit that had been so starved to death that even my globe load was being eaten every night.
A friend who also has some e-loading business asked my why I just load 20 PHP per day everyday instead of loading a hundred which would suffice me for five days and I told him the reason, and then all he told me was there was no problem regarding Globe’s network but there were only a few shortcomings that Globe never did which was to inform their users that their load credit expiration was now strict to the time duration.
Back then my 10 peso load would last for a week or two, but now it only lasts for 24 hours or even less. I observed for a few days and I found out that since I do regster to sulitxt or unlitxt right after I load up then the expiration of my e-laod was also in sync with my registration to Globe’s services.
